Anyway, I'm not blaming anyone, >>>> just pointing out what I think is a mistake. >>> So this is not for the user but for the port? >>> >>> I'll do a swap on the tree for it, because I'm sure there are more >>> ports doing something like: >>> .ifndef(NO_INSTALL_MANPAGES) >>> ...... >>> .endif > I was talking to itectu@ about this, and figured it would be better in > Mk/bsd.port.mk. > > >> The general rule of thumb is: if it doesn't begin with WITH_ or >> WITHOUT_, it's not user-settable. NO_INSTALL_MANPAGES is used for >> ports using imake that don't understand the install.man target. > /me thought that was the USE_ vs WITH(OUT)?_ difference. > > NO* is supposed to be user settable right ? While I am here, have you gotten my email about scons? http://lists.freebsd.org/pipermail/cvs-ports/2008-July/153324.html ---------------------------------------------- # pkg_info -IX scons scons-0.98.5 A build tool alternative to make # ls /usr/local/man/man1/ | grep scons scons-time.1.gz scons.1.gz sconsign.1.gz # pkg_delete -f scons-0.98.5 # ls /usr/local/man/man1/ | grep scons [...empty...] # cd /usr/ports/devel/scons # grep NO Makefile .if !defined (NO_INSTALL_MANPAGES) # make NO_INSTALL_MANPAGES=yes install [...] Installed SCons scripts into /usr/local/bin Installed SCons man pages into /usr/local/man/man1 ===> Registering installation for scons-0.98.5 # ls /usr/local/man/man1/ | grep scons scons-time.1 scons.1 sconsign.1 # pkg_delete -f scons-0.98.5 # ls /usr/local/man/man1/ | grep scons scons-time.1 scons.1 sconsign.1 ---------------------------------------------- The scons plist is broke with NO_INSTALL_MANPAGES.
